How effective is the Simplified Acquisition Procedure (SAP) in ensuring competitive pricing for this type of service?
Simplified Acquisition Procedures (SAP) are designed to streamline the procurement process for purchases below a certain threshold (currently $250,000, though this can be higher for certain categories). While SAP aims to increase efficiency and reduce administrative burden, its effectiveness in ensuring robust price competition depends on how widely the opportunity is publicized and the number of vendors that respond. For a contract valued at $930,000, it's possible this was awarded in increments or that the SAP threshold was higher for this specific type of service. Generally, SAP can lead to good pricing if multiple qualified vendors participate, but it may not achieve the same level of competition as full and open competition for larger contracts.
